Puerto Natales

A rancher vibe mixes with the ever-growing adventure activity scene in this city, which serves as the gateway to the famous Torres del Paine National Park. Climb the Cerro Dorotea (Dorotea Hill) to look at Puerto Natales from above; if you’re lucky, you’ll be able to see the majestic flight of the condor that nests on the vertical walls of the hill. Discover the Cueva del Milodón (Milodon Cave) in the southernmost part of Chile and get to know the history of the giant sloth that used to live there more than 10,000 years ago. Sail through the Fiordo Última Esperanza (Last Hope fjord) and be amazed by the glaciers you’ll find during the trip.
